Berlin-Karow station

On 17 April 2009, twenty-four people were injured when a regional train from Stralsund, Mecklenburg-Vorpommern, crashed into a freight train carrying propane, north of Berlin.

[3] The passengers and railway staff were hurt in the accident which took place 250m outside of Berlin-Karow railway station.

[4] Nine of the injured,[5] five of them in critical condition, were taken to nearby hospitals.
